1. Setting Boundaries

This is an important therapy topic to discuss because it enables us to take control of our lives. Setting boundaries provides us with an understanding of our personal values and beliefs and helps us to express them. By defining our individual limits, we remain in control of who and what we allow into our lives.

Setting boundaries can also help us grow, learn, and improve by providing us with guidelines for making difficult choices. When we set boundaries, we are healthier and more capable of achieving our goals.

It can also provide us with a sense of security by allowing us to be assertive about our needs and wants in any and all situations. This allows us to honor our own feelings and respect the feelings of others, enabling us to maintain healthier relationships.

5. Relationships

Relationships have the power to both profoundly uplift us and profoundly hurt us. We all need relationships to thrive and survive. They are an essential factor in our well-being and mental health. 

Therapy can help us understand all the components that make up a relationship, from how our childhoods shaped our capacity to give and receive love to how communication can be improved.

Whether we’re struggling to get along with our parents, dealing with issues in a relationship, or trying to let go of a broken one, discussing it with a good therapist can help us move forward and heal.

Therapy is an invaluable tool to use to better understand ourselves and our relationships and find better ways to nurture them.

6. Self-Esteem

Self-esteem is an important issue to discuss in therapy as it relates to how individuals perceive and value themselves. It acts as the foundation on which personal growth is built. Having healthy self-esteem can provide individuals with the confidence to pursue their goals and live their lives to the fullest.

It can also protect them from the negative effects of criticism and rejection. Without it, individuals can feel helpless, discouraged, and unmotivated. Building self-esteem can empower individuals to love and accept themselves, setting a strong foundation for them to conquer their goals and live a life they can be proud of.

8. Addressing Past Trauma

Addressing past trauma is important because it can help people heal and move on from the painful experiences of their past. When people take the time to recognize what they’ve gone through and talk through it, it can help them process their feelings and make sense of what they’ve been through. It can provide a sense of closure and help to create healthier coping strategies for future challenges.

Not addressing past trauma can lead to a sense of unresolved issues, difficulty letting go, and increased feelings of anger and anxiety, amongst other things. It can also result in people struggling to form meaningful relationships and lead healthy, balanced lives.
